Golden Bush Scallop
Golden Bush Scallop is a golden-yellow, plump Patty Pan squash that grows on space-saving bush plants. Prolific and hardy, the plants bear continuously over a long season and show resistance to downy mildew, with fruits best harvested at 4 to 5 inches across. The flavor is considered superior to other scallop varieties, and the squash can be boiled, fried, or stir-fried.
